

Few pleasures in Chinatown are as simple and satisfying as a dim sum repast: plates of buns, steamer baskets of dumplings and pots of tea to fill in the corners of a Sunday morning or weekday afternoon. This Chinatown spot has a long Cantonese menu, but it’s our favorite for its a la carte dim sum (everything made to order, no trolleys), with an exceptional selection of sweeter buns and cakes from its adjacent bakery.
